What is PEG Feeding?
PEG feeding describes a dietary assistance approach where a tube is put through the stomach wall surface right into the belly. It enables direct delivery of food, fluids, and medications to clients unable to eat by mouth. Usually advised for individuals dealing with neurological problems, head and neck cancers cells, or various other debilitating conditions, the method guarantees that people receive the nutrients they need.

Understanding Enteral Nutrition Support
1. What is Enteral Nourishment Support?
Enteral nourishment assistance includes giving nutrition via the stomach tract when oral intake is insufficient or not feasible. It includes several techniques including PEG feeding, which is commonly chosen because of its minimally invasive nature.
2. Types of Enteral Feeding Methods
- Nasogastric Tubes: Inserted via the nose into the stomach. Oro-gastric Tubes: Inserted via the mouth right into the stomach. Gastrostomy Tubes: Operatively positioned directly into the tummy (PEG).
3. Benefits of Enteral Nutrition
- Ensures ample nutrient intake Reduces complications associated with malnutrition Supports healing in critically sick patients

FAQs
1. What credentials do I need for a PEG feeding training course?
Most programs require individuals to have a background in nursing or allied health careers; nonetheless, access requirements differ by institution.
2. How long do these qualification programs take?
Typically, brief programs can vary from someday to several weeks depending upon depth and intricacy; longer programs might cross months with sophisticated material included.

3. Are there on the internet alternatives available?
Yes! Many organizations currently offer on the internet components together with functional components to accommodate differing timetables and locations throughout Australia.
4. What will certainly I receive upon completion?
Participants usually obtain a certification indicating their competency; some might also acquire Proceeding Specialist Development (CPD) credit histories depending on program certification status.
